Overview

  • A control judge in the State of Mexico ordered the immediate release of Alejandro Germán “N” (“Lord Pádel”) and Othón “N” after validating amparo suspensions that shielded them from arrest.
  • Karla Alejandra “N” and her son Germán “N” remain in preventive detention at the Barrientos prison as their legal status is addressed in subsequent hearings.
  • The four are investigated for attempted qualified homicide linked to the July 19 beating of instructor Israel Morales at a padel club in Atizapán de Zaragoza, an incident recorded on widely shared video.
  • The arrests occurred on August 14 at Cancún International Airport in a coordinated operation involving the FGJEM, FGR, Interpol México and CONASE before the transfer to Tlalnepantla.
  • Prosecutors continue to compile medical examinations, witness statements and video evidence, and the two released defendants must continue the case under court conditions.
